After you have read this chapter, you should be able to:
● Identify four major HR challenges currently facing
organizations and managers.
● List and define each of the seven major categories of HR
activities.
● Identify the three different roles of HR management.
● Discuss the three dimensions associated with HR
management as a strategic business contributor.
● Explain why HR professionals and operating managers
must view HR management as an interface.
● Discuss why ethical issues and professionalism affect HR
management as a career field.
